Definition of «cellular metabolism»

Cellular metabolism refers to all the chemical reactions that take place within a cell, which are necessary for maintaining life. These reactions involve breaking down nutrients from food into energy (ATP), building and repairing molecules such as proteins and DNA, and carrying out various other essential functions.

Cellular metabolism is divided into two main categories: anabolism and catabolism. Anabolism involves the synthesis of complex organic compounds from simpler ones, while catabolism involves the breakdown of these complex molecules to release energy or produce simpler substances that can be used by the cell.

Overall, cellular metabolism is a highly regulated process that ensures cells have the necessary resources and energy to carry out their functions effectively.
